Job description
-
Uses computers and computer systems (including hardware and software) to set up functions, enter data, or process information.
-
Monitors, verifies and manages the acquisition and maintenance of property based systems.
-
Assists in analyzing information, identifying current and potential problems and proposing solutions.
-
Maintains, inspects and repairs equipment.
-
Inspects the equipment or the environment.
-
Verifies that computer and network operations are monitored at the property, backup/recovery functions are performed on scheduled basis and administration functions for hardware, operating and application systems are maintained and completed on consistent basis.
-
Supports managing IR activities to confirm the property infrastructure and applications systems are functional at all times.
-
Verifies solutions are consistent with the client's needs and brand specific IR environment.
-
Administers and maintains mail and email.
-
Maintains inventories and manages IT hardware/software.
-
Provides Internet support and maintenance (if applicable)
-
Provides cable management support.
-
Generates systems communications for property users to introduce new applications, provide user tips, alert users of system problems and inform staff of progress or status.
-
Consults on specific application issues or hardware/software problems.
-
Provides feedback to Lodging IR on application functional performance and system performance.
